"Home Queries Genealogy History Tools & Links Guestbook Contact Me   Piute County Genealogical Resources Native American Resources Extracted Documents Relating to the "Paiute Indian Tribe of Utah Restoration Act" of 1983 (the unabridged documents will be posted when time permits) Contents Public Law 96-227 Hearing before the Select Committee on Indian Affairs, 2 November 1983 Statement of Patrick Charles Supporting Documentation Prepared for the House Interior and Insular Affairs Committee Chapter 1: Socio-Economic Status of the Paiutes Chapter 2: Historical Perspective Early History Consolidation Establishment of Reservations Allotment Indian Reorganization Act Indian Claims Commission Termination Restoration Chapter 3: Reservation Planning Process   Public Law 96-227 An Act to restore to the Shivwits, Kanosh, Koosharem, and Indian Peaks Bands of Paiute Indians of Utah, and with respect to the Cedar City Band of Paiute Indians of Utah, to restore or confirm, the Federal trust relationship, to restore to members of such Bands those Federal services and benefits furnished to American Indian Tribes by reason of such trust relationship, and for other purposes.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led, That this Act may be cited as the "Paiute Indian Tribe of Utah Restoration Act". Sec. 2. For the purposes of this Act -- (1) the term "tribe" means the Cedar City, Shivwits, Kanosh, Koosharem, and Indian Peaks Bands of Paiute Indians of Utah; ... (4) the term "member", when used with respect to the tribe, means a person enrolled on the membership roll of the tribe, as provided in section 4 "
